The Picks:

Disney Magic Kingdom 1Disney Magic Kingdom Comics #1 – IDW Publishing continues Disneyland’s Diamond anniversary celebration with a new  anthology. Disney characters have been having park-themed adventures for decades, such as Scrooge McDuck traveling the Mark Twain Riverboat and reminiscing about his days as a riverboat captain, and Donald and Mickey investigating the strange disappearance of the Country Bear Jamboree. This issue is the first Disneyland-themed anthology comic in 30 years and features many beloved Disney comics artists, including Carl Barks. This is an issue Disney fans won’t want to miss.

Darkwing Duck 2016 2Disney’s Darkwing Duck #2 – The Terror that Flaps in the Night returns in his all-new ongoing comic series from Joe Books. Darkwing is trapped inside St. Canard Prison for the Criminally Conniving, where villains Megavolt and Negaduck have unleashed the collective might of the inmates. It’s time to Get Dangerous as Darkwing has to discover who’s really behind all this tomfoolery all alone—or does he? The Darkwing Duck reboot from several years ago really lit fans up, and now he’s back to do it all over again.
